PNB offers subsidized home loans on New Year eve

The bank has also offered to disburse loans at a fixed interest rate of 8.5 percent while slashing the margin from 30 per cent to 15 per cent payable by the customer. “This measure has been taken to ensure credit to borrowers at a lower rate during the festive season for borrowing period of three years,” PNB said.
